Pattinson's Watch Deal: Jaeger-LeCoultre Ambassador Role Announced

Robert Pattinson has been appointed as the new global ambassador for luxury watchmaker Jaeger-LeCoultre. The actor, who is currently filming 'The Batman' and has several films releasing this year, expressed admiration for the brand's craftsmanship. Jaeger-LeCoultre CEO Jérôme Lambert praised Pattinson's artistic depth and independent spirit.
Pattinson's appointment arrives during a notably busy professional stretch, as he balances principal photography on *The Batman* with a slate of upcoming releases including *Primetime*, *The Odyssey*, and *Dune: Part Three*. His production company, Icki Eneo Arlo, is also developing several projects, including an adaptation of *Possession* starring Margaret Qualley.
The actor joins an ambassador roster that includes South Korean artist IU, Jackson Lee, Kim Woo-Bin, Zhang Ziyi, and Lenny Kravitz, with his campaign set to roll out through mid-September. Jaeger-LeCoultre frames the partnership as deepening its cultural touchpoints, leveraging Pattinson's independent career trajectory and established filmography spanning *The Twilight Saga* to *Mickey 17*.
